I am working in the field of oncolytic virotherapy for more than 9 years. I engineered several oncolytic viruses mostly from Adenovirus and Vaccinia virus. I did many in vitro and in vivo studies to check the potency and safety of this kind of drug. Honestly speaking, I have pretty great feeling and hope in near future. Yes! I strongly believe that Oncolytic viruses will be the key drug but we need to understand more about tumor microenvironment, immune status and barriers of delivery system to the target.
